SASE Features You Should Care About

  • Advanced Security as a Service

    Appliance-based security stacks cannot connect remote users. SASE delivers a unified security standard to all enterprise edges, including built-in access governance, IPS, next-gen firewalls & secure web gateways to support remote work from anywhere, at any time.

  • Worldwide Reach

    A robust backbone guarantees maximum speed, simplicity, and continuity of connection – when provider POPs worldwide are spread where your users are.

  • Scalability at Ease

    Experience 1-day, hardware-free branch setups and instant connectivity for remote users for unfettered business expansion, anywhere in the world.

  • Real-Time Optimization & Repair

    Self-repair and traffic routing optimization capabilities reduce your maintenance costs while preventing downtime or latencies for your users and critical workflows.

SASE: The Future of Enterprise Networking is Now

Most networking and security solutions today are still painfully incompatible with a cloud-centric business ecosystem. Secure Access Service Edge (SASE) fuses enterprise network and its security layer into a single, cloud-based platform. Think of it as network-plus-security-as-a-service.     What is SASE? Your 2021 Definitive guide

    Pronounced ‘sassy’, SASE (Secure Access Service Edge), is a terminology first proposed by Gartner. While there are many definitions of SASE, it can be simply said to be a network architecture that combines the capabilities of SD-WAN with network security functions and delivers it as a service delivered via the cloud.
